Causes of Water Logging:

The roots of water logging often trace back to rapid urbanization, improper city planning, and inadequate drainage systems. As cities expand, natural water channels are often replaced by concrete structures, impeding the natural flow of water. Additionally, poorly designed drainage systems struggle to cope with heavy rainfall, leading to stagnant water in low-lying areas. Human activities such as deforestation and improper waste disposal further exacerbate the problem by disrupting the natural water balance.

Consequences for Urban Areas:

The consequences of water logging are multifaceted, impacting both infrastructure and public health. Roads and transportation networks bear the brunt, with flooded streets disrupting daily commutes and causing damage to vehicles. Beyond the immediate inconvenience, water logging can lead to structural damage to buildings and public spaces, compromising their integrity over time. Furthermore, stagnant water becomes a breeding ground for disease-carrying vectors, posing a severe threat to public health.

Environmental Impact:

The environmental repercussions of water logging are equally concerning. Prolonged water stagnation depletes soil fertility, making it unsuitable for agriculture. Aquatic ecosystems suffer as well, with increased pollution and reduced oxygen levels in water bodies affecting flora and fauna. The overall ecological balance is disrupted, leading to long-term consequences for biodiversity and environmental sustainability.

Urban Planning and Management:

Addressing water logging requires a holistic approach to urban planning and management. Cities need robust drainage systems capable of handling excess water during heavy rainfall. Integrating green spaces, permeable pavements, and water retention areas into urban designs can help absorb excess water and mitigate the impact of water logging. Strategic zoning and land-use planning also play crucial roles in minimizing vulnerability to flooding.

Community Involvement:

Engaging communities in the process is key to sustainable solutions. Public awareness campaigns about responsible waste disposal and the importance of maintaining natural drainage channels can foster a sense of shared responsibility. Communities can also participate in local initiatives, such as tree planting or cleaning water channels, to contribute to the overall resilience of their neighborhoods.
